Understanding Prompts and Their Benefits
Prompts are cues or starting points that guide content creation. They can be questions, themes, keywords, or scenarios designed to spark ideas. Using prompts offers several advantages:
- Enhanced Creativity: Prompts challenge writers to think differently and explore new angles.
- Consistency: They help maintain a steady flow of ideas, especially during brainstorming sessions.
- Efficiency: Prompts reduce the time spent on deciding what to write about.
- SEO Optimization: Well-crafted prompts can incorporate keywords that improve search engine rankings.
Types of Prompts for Content Creation
Different prompts serve various purposes. Understanding these types can help tailor your content strategy effectively.
Question Prompts
These prompts pose questions that your content will answer. They are excellent for creating informative articles, FAQs, and tutorials.
Theme Prompts
Theme prompts focus on specific topics or ideas, guiding content around a central subject to ensure relevance and focus.
Keyword Prompts
Incorporating targeted keywords into prompts helps optimize content for search engines, increasing visibility and traffic.
How to Use Prompts Effectively
To maximize the benefits of prompts, follow these best practices:
- Customize Prompts: Tailor prompts to fit your niche and audience.
- Mix and Match: Combine different prompt types to generate diverse content ideas.
- Set Clear Objectives: Define what you want to achieve with each prompt, such as educating, entertaining, or converting.
- Use Tools: Leverage AI tools and content generators to create prompts and expand ideas.
- Review and Refine: Regularly assess the effectiveness of your prompts and adjust them accordingly.
Implementing Prompts in Your Content Workflow
Integrate prompts seamlessly into your content creation process for consistent results:
- Brainstorm Sessions: Use prompts as starting points during team meetings or solo brainstorming.
- Content Calendars: Schedule prompts to guide your editorial calendar and ensure a steady stream of ideas.
- Creative Exercises: Use prompts for daily writing exercises to boost creativity and productivity.
- Review and Revise: Revisit prompts regularly to generate new angles and update existing content.
